Legal Landscape For Cbd Distribution

Navigating the Farm Bill reveals complexities for CBD distributors. The 2018 Farm Bill legalized hemp-derived CBD, yet, it must contain less than 0.3% THC. This distinction is crucial for compliance and avoiding legal repercussions.

Understanding state laws and regulations is equally vital. Region-specific rules vary widely. Distributors must stay informed about the legality of CBD in their targeted areas. Some states have strict testing and labeling requirements. Others may have ambiguous policies, requiring extra caution and legal advice.

CBD vs. THC: The main legal implication lies in their psychoactive effects. THC is known for the ‘high’, while CBD does not produce such an effect. This difference places CBD in a more favorable legal position under federal law, given the THC content is within legal limits.

Licensing And Compliance Essentials

To become a CBD distributor, first, ensure you obtain the necessary permits. Research your state’s specific legal requirements. Most areas demand a business license and a reseller’s permit. It’s crucial to stay up-to-date on changes in cannabis laws.

Next, adhere to quality and lab testing standards. CBD products must often meet purity criteria. It means you’ll need to partner with a reputable laboratory. They will test your products for THC levels and contaminants. This is a vital step to ensure consumer safety and trust in your brand.

  • Research your state’s legal requirements.
  • Obtain a business license and reseller’s permit.
  • Stay informed about legal changes.
  • Partner with a trusted laboratory for product testing.
  • Ensure products meet purity and safety standards.

Challenges And Solutions In Cbd Distribution

Entering the CBD market presents unique hurdles. Banking and payment processing are first on the list. Traditional banks often reject CBD businesses due to federal regulations. To counter this, seek specialized financial institutions with experience in high-risk sectors.

Public skepticism can hinder a CBD distributor’s growth. Education is key. Distributors must provide clear, accessible information on CBD’s benefits. This builds trust and credibility with potential customers.

Ensuring the same quality across all products sustains customer satisfaction. Batch testing and partnerships with reputable suppliers are critical. They guarantee consistent product quality and potency, solidifying consumer confidence.
